0

私はフラッシュに非常に慣れていないので、書き込もうとしているプログラムで立ち往生しています。基本的に、ユーザーがフレーム2のボックスにテキストを入力すると、そのテキストがフレーム6に表示されます。ただし、次のエラーが発生し続けます。

シーン1、レイヤー'アクション'、フレーム6、16行目1180:未定義の可能性があるメソッドmyDataを呼び出します。

フレーム2のコードは次のとおりです。

var myData:String; stepper1.addEventListener(Event.CHANGE,myHandler);
function myHandler(evt:Event):void {  myData = stepper1.text; }

そしてフレーム6のコード:

output1.text = myData(stepper1.text);
4

1 に答える 1

0

myData は、関数としてではなく文字列として定義されています。やってみました:

output1.text = myData;
于 2013-03-11T19:21:15.877 に答える